Matthew Henry, a renowned theologian and commentator, believed that waiting on God is not simply a passive act of sitting idly by, but rather an active pursuit of God's presence and will in our lives. To wait on God is to live a life of desire towards him, delight in him, dependence on him, and devotedness to him.

First and foremost, waiting on God involves a deep desire for his presence and guidance in our lives. This desire is not a fleeting emotion, but a constant longing for intimacy with God. It is a recognition that our souls are restless until they find their rest in him. As Psalm 42:1 says, "As the deer pants for streams of water, so my soul pants for you, my God."

Secondly, waiting on God involves finding delight in him. This delight comes from knowing that God is good, faithful, and loving towards us. It is a joy that surpasses all understanding, even in the midst of trials and tribulations. As Psalm 37:4 says, "Take delight in the Lord, and he will give you the desires of your heart."

Furthermore, waiting on God requires a complete dependence on him. It is an acknowledgment that we are weak and in need of his strength and provision. It is a surrender of our own plans and desires to his perfect will. As Proverbs 3:5-6 says, "Trust in the Lord with all your heart and lean not on your own understanding; in all your ways submit to him, and he will make your paths straight."

Lastly, waiting on God involves a devotedness to him. It is a commitment to seek him first in all things and to follow his ways above all else. It is a dedication to living a life that honors and glorifies him in all that we do. As Psalm 27:4 says, "One thing I ask from the Lord, this only do I seek: that I may dwell in the house of the Lord all the days of my life, to gaze on the beauty of the Lord and to seek him in his temple."
